Risks of flood and surface runoff in Mediterranean metropolises : case of western part of Grand Algiers

The Grand Algiers was built on the Sahel foothills. Like other Mediterranean metropolises, it fits in a context of strong cyclogenetic instability, which manifests by floods and the surface runoffs. However, the Grand Algiers makes the exception with the scale which takes the damages after the passage of one of these meteorological events. The event of November 9-10th, 2001, which affected the western part of Grand Algiers, reflects perfectly this situation. Floods activated by this event caused damage to the property and loss of life, which are unequalled in the Mediterranean Basin. In this work, by using classic tools and numerical simulation, we tried to understand the behaviour of the whole hydrosystem (meteorological, geomorphological, and anthropogenic factors). Then we have classified the predisposing, triggering, and aggravating factors of flooding and surface runoff. The results of all the anal-yses serve for quantifying and mapping the risk. To conclude, we made various management proposals (combination of structural and non structural measures), in order to reduce the im-portant level of present risk
